Wind Predictive Maintenance Specialist- Vibration Analysis specialist, Hybrid Oklahoma City, OK.
Enel North America is a proven renewables leader delivering clean, flexible and sustainable energy solutions. The Wind Predictive Maintenance Specialist will focus on the predictive maintenance and condition-based monitoring program, conducting vibration analysis, making maintenance recommendations, and ensuring effective monitoring of the wind fleet.

Responsibilities
Participate in the condition-based monitoring (CMS) program in EGPNA (vibration, oil and grease analysis, borescopes, blades) from collecting information, reviewing results, making inspection/ repair recommendations and reviewing work performed by OEMs or ISPs. Strong focus on drive train vibration measurement, analysis and proactive problem detection
Perform real time monitoring and case management of the EGPNA fleet utilizing vibration alarming and diagnostics software
Complete full predictive maintenance analytics, including CMS analysis, temperature analysis, tribology analysis, and case management
Perform SCADA data mining and diagnosis for performance control and proactive problem solving
Evaluate improvement options from OEMs or ISPs
Monitor the implementation of new procedures, retrofits, and predictive maintenance technologies
Make maintenance recommendations
Review components inspection reports and recommendations from both internal personnel and third parties, and ensure actions are taken based on that information
Perform End of Warranty inspections. Build EoW reports to submit to OEM prior to the end of the warranty periods
Analysis and monitoring of alarms, faults and incidences across the EGPNA wind fleet
Maintain required training certifications and qualifications
Write Technical Specifications on necessary parts and/ or services
